About Hafodyrynys
Hafodyrynys is a village located in the Caerphilly county borough of Wales. It lies within the NP11 postcode area and is situated close to the town of Newbridge. The village is primarily residential, with a mix of local amenities catering to the needs of its residents. The surrounding landscape features typical Welsh countryside, providing opportunities for outdoor activities and walks. The village has a strong sense of community, with local events and gatherings that foster connections among residents. Public transport links are available, making it convenient for those wishing to travel to nearby towns or explore the wider region. Hafodyrynys serves as a peaceful place for families and individuals alike, offering a simple lifestyle while being close to larger urban areas.

House Prices in Hafodyrynys
Property prices average £173K across the area, and terraced houses are the most common property type, typically selling for £126K.
